Comic Book Workshop with Tom McLaughlin - Brewhouse, Taunton
Waterstones Children’s Book Festival
Join author and illustrator, Tom McLaughlin to celebrate the release of the second instalment in his graphic novel series, Alan, King of the Universe - a side-splittingly funny adventures about a cat born with opposable thumbs and bent on world domination. Tom will teach children how to create comic strips and how to draw some of the characters from his laugh-out-loud graphic novel.
Suitable for budding artists aged 7 + years
Paper and pencils will be provided but children are encouraged to bring their own sketch books and pencils/pens.
